Train Sim World 6 invites you to master formidable trains across three new routes, experiencing the realistic challenges of train simulation with detailed operational mechanics. You manage acceleration, braking, signaling, and route navigation in scenarios designed to test your mastery of authentic locomotive operation. The simulation focuses on the methodical skill of real train operation rather than arcade action, appealing to players who enjoy precision and attention to detail. The generally positive reviews come from enthusiasts who appreciate the technical authenticity and route variety, though it's inherently niche. Why Does the Train Sim World® 6 Price Vary by Country?
Steam uses a regional pricing model, which means Train Sim World® 6 can cost significantly more or less depending on where you buy it. Publishers set different prices for each country based on local purchasing power — regions like Turkey, Argentina, and India typically have much lower prices than Western Europe or North America. Currency exchange rates, local taxes, and market competition also play a role. This is why Train Sim World® 6 can cost $12.99 in one country and $49.26 in another.
